crowbar/crowbar-ha

View on GitHub
chef/cookbooks/pacemaker/files/default/sbd_remote.service

Summary

Maintainability
Test Coverage
[Unit]
Description=Shared-storage based fencing daemon
Before=pacemaker_remote.service
After=systemd-modules-load.service iscsi.service
PartOf=pacemaker_remote.service
RefuseManualStop=true
RefuseManualStart=true

[Service]
Type=forking
ExecStart=/usr/share/sbd/sbd.sh start
ExecStop=/usr/share/sbd/sbd.sh stop
PIDFile=/var/run/sbd.pid
# Could this benefit from exit codes for restart?
# Does this need to be set to msgwait * 1.2?
# TimeoutSec=
# If SBD crashes, it'll very likely suicide immediately due to the
# hardware watchdog. But one can always try.
Restart=on-abort

[Install]
RequiredBy=pacemaker_remote.service